Magnolia Manor in Wasilla, AK is a warm and inviting board and care home that offers a range of services to ensure the comfort and well-being of its residents. The community is fully furnished and boasts amenities such as a dining room, small library, outdoor space, and a garden for residents to enjoy. Housekeeping services are provided to maintain a clean and tidy living environment.
Residents can expect personalized care services that include assistance with activities of daily living such as bathing, dressing, and transfers. Special attention is given to those with diabetes, with staff trained in providing diabetes diets. Medication management is also available to ensure residents receive their medications on schedule.
The dining experience at Magnolia Manor is tailored to accommodate special dietary restrictions, ensuring that each resident's nutrition needs are met. Additionally, the community offers scheduled daily activities to keep residents engaged and entertained.

Assisted living provides moderate support for seniors seeking independence, while memory care offers specialized support for individuals with dementia or cognitive impairments through structured routines and trained staff. Key differences include care approaches, environment security measures, staff training levels, activity types, and cost considerations.
